13+ requirement

Target Practice is intended for users age 13 or older. We do not ask for dates of birth; age gates should store only eligibility acknowledgement when needed. If you believe a child under 13 provided information without verifiable parental consent, contact professorw@targetpracticelearning.com for product support, with founder@targetpracticelearning.com as the backup administrative contact so we can delete it.

Student data we may collect

We may collect email, display name, account role, diagnostic answers, selected test type, score goals, practice attempts, progress data, support messages, AI tutor/chat messages, beta feedback, scholarship profile fields, sourced scholarship URLs, extracted scholarship requirement fields, anonymous beta session identifiers, and subscription or Stripe identifiers. We avoid collecting school IDs, official transcripts, district records, or dates of birth in this beta.

Why we collect it

We use student data to operate diagnostics, recommend practice, save progress, organize scholarship workflows, provide support, maintain subscriptions, debug issues, and improve educational features. Analytics should use user IDs or anonymous tester IDs rather than names or emails whenever practical.

Students and parents

Target Practice is currently a beta product for use with parent or guardian involvement when a student is a minor. Parent and student account roles should remain separate as account features mature.

AI processing

AI-assisted explanations and support may be processed by AI providers. Do not enter full names, school identifiers, student IDs, addresses, health details, financial information, private portal credentials, or other unnecessary personal information into AI chat or support prompts. We may redact common identifiers before AI processing, but users should still avoid sharing sensitive details.

No sale of student data

We do not sell student personal information. Any future advertising, school, scholarship-provider, or analytics partnerships require privacy review and attorney-approved policy updates before launch.

School and FERPA-related data

Target Practice is not an official school records system and should not be used to store official transcripts, district records, school IDs, or teacher-uploaded identifiable records unless a school agreement, DPA, FERPA review, and attorney-reviewed language are in place.

What not to enter

During beta, do not enter payment card numbers, Social Security numbers, medical information, tax records, or other highly sensitive personal information into product forms or support messages.

Payments

Live payment processing is not enabled yet. When Stripe checkout is added, payment card data should be entered only into Stripe-hosted or Stripe-controlled checkout surfaces. Target Practice should store Stripe customer, checkout, subscription, or payment method identifiers only, not raw card numbers, CVC, or expiration details.

Third-party sources

If you paste public scholarship page text or source URLs, the product may store a limited excerpt and extracted fields to help you verify requirements. Do not paste private portal pages, tax records, Social Security numbers, medical information, or copyrighted materials you do not have permission to use.

Deletion and export requests

Use the support page or email professorw@targetpracticelearning.com for product support, with founder@targetpracticelearning.com as the backup administrative contact to request account deletion, data deletion, or a copy of available account data. The deletion workflow should remove or anonymize profile data, progress, quiz attempts, saved answers, AI/support chat logs, scholarship workflow data, subscription references, and analytics references where legally and technically feasible.
